## Step 4: Payroll Export Cutover

Heads up — Ledgerly v9 switches payroll exports from fixed-width to the new columnar format. Before flipping the flag, run the backfill script so historical exports get re-encoded. The script reads legacy rows straight from the payroll database, so point it at the connection string below.

replica DSN, tawef-hahap: mysql://eliix_svc:FiIC0jz@db-394a.lumiclabs.internal:5432/holius

Ticket: Staging env misconfigured for Siftgate bloom filter

The bloom layer in front of the Pellet KV store is rejecting all lookups in staging because the env file was copied from the dev template without credentials. False-positive tuning values are fine; only the auth line is missing. To unblock the weekly demo, the Pellet admission secret must be set on the following line.

env line for yaguf-fajop: LEDGER_TOKEN13=fb08984397349

## v1.9.2

Renamed `WS_RETRY_MS` to `BRAMBLE_RECONNECT_BACKOFF_MS` after the reconnect storm in the Okerton fleet, where the old name hid that the value was a base for exponential backoff. Reviewers: verify no manifest still sets the old key, as it now aborts startup. The reconnect handshake also authenticates, and its credential belongs on the next line.

secret setting of yafof-tawep: RELAY_SECRET8=8abb5772